Sounds good. > According to undo-tree.el, it's already copyright the FSF, but it also > says it's part of Emacs, which is surely false. `undo-tree' is in GNU ELPA, and GNU ELPA packages are kind of half-way between being part of Emacs and not being part of it (e.g. for copyright purposes we consider them part of Emacs, i.e. a copyright assignment for Emacs changes is accepted as covering changes in GNU ELPA). So some packages in GNU ELPA say "part of Emacs", others say "not part of Emacs", and I think they're both right and wrong.
